What is the Becket List Book all about I hear you ask

An A to Z of First World Problems is… just that.  The Becket List is a not entirely serious compendium of 'First World Problems' - the sort of stuff that drives us round the bend on a daily basis. How is it that atonal music, bus stations, cling-film and coat-hangers can bugger us up so comprehensively?  Or passport control people, modern poetry, or just about anything you'll find in a typical hotel bedroom? 

Embracing both the inanimate - from allen keys to rawlplugs - and the animated (well, in some cases) - from your fellow-travellers to every third-rate waiter who ever walked the earth - this book is essential for your sanity. 

As such, this comprehensive A to Z provides a signal service to humanity.  A collection of entries about many of the things in life that, whilst essentially trivial, day after day contrive to b*gger you up.  In the greater scheme of things they don’t matter a damn, but in the context of advanced civilisation they take on a huge significance. The book is both an important resource for future social historians and a call to action. It’s also, mostly, really rather silly.

About Henry Becket

Henry Becket was one of that curious breed, a Choral Exhibitioner at Cambridge, where he read... books. And magazines. He then spent decades nurturing what a head hunter once described as an iffy CV – as a Westminster speechwriter, lobbyist, wine merchant, copywriter, ad agency supremo (industry-speak for MD), and writer/director of innumerable eminently forgettable TV commercials in an awful lot of languages. He is lucky enough to have an impressively large family and is also pretty obsessed with sailing, skiing, claret, churches and hillwalking, among other things. Oh, and the foibles of the world around him. Obvs.
